
Brandon Thomas Asante
Brandon Thomas Asante is an emerging football talent who made an impact in the recent Unity Cup semi-final, scoring a goal for Ghana in their 2-1 loss to Nigeria, showcasing his potential as a valuable player for the Black Stars.
